Scott McGrory (born 5 April 1987 in Bellshill) is a Scottish footballer currently playing for Harrogate Town.
He has been a reserve team regular at Oakwell throughout the 2006/07 and 2007/08 seasons.
On 12th March 2008, Scott signed for Conference North side Harrogate Town and went straight into the squad to play Solihull Moors .
